Preliminary agricultural credit committees provide loans to their farmer members at an interest rate of 5%. This rate is part of the government's initiative to support agricultural financing.

The interest rate is set at 5%, which is aimed at making financial support accessible to farmers.
These committees are vital in strengthening the agricultural sector by providing affordable credit.

Preliminary agricultural credit committees are part of the cooperative structure that aids farmers.
The interest rates offered are generally lower compared to commercial banks to support farmers in need.
